Any advice on feeding fruits & veggies?

Does any one have any suggestions for getting my tegu to eat fruits and veggies when they're offered? Right now i'm just constantly introducing, but she just smells them and walks away until she gets her crickets and dubias :p Any helpful suggestions are appreciated

Take one or two of the dubias or crickets and squish them up into a bit of a paste and then spread that around on the pieces of fruit/veg.

Try berries - I found that Ruby (juvenile red tegu) took them quite well at the start, especially blueberries.

For veggies, try something like peas or broccoli mixed into ground meat or liver. At first Ruby would accept only a little bit, but now she's used to the taste and eats it all the time along with her meat.
